Description

Australia Corporate Bonds: BBB-rated: 5 Years: Spread to AGS data was reported at 130.730 Basis Point in Apr 2018. This records an increase from the previous number of 122.210 Basis Point for Mar 2018. Australia Corporate Bonds: BBB-rated: 5 Years: Spread to AGS data is updated monthly, averaging 221.005 Basis Point from Jan 2005 to Apr 2018, with 160 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 941.010 Basis Point in Nov 2008 and a record low of 90.310 Basis Point in Mar 2006. Australia Corporate Bonds: BBB-rated: 5 Years: Spread to AGS data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by Reserve Bank of Australia.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Australia – Table AU.M008: Corporate Bond Yield and Spread.
